## Project Overview
|
||
|
||
Cloudflare Worker-based AI server recommendation service. Uses OpenAI GPT-4o-mini (via AI Gateway), D1 database, KV cache, and VPS benchmark data to recommend cost-effective servers based on natural language requirements.

### Key Data Flow
|
||
|
||
1. User sends request (`tech_stack`, `expected_users`, `use_case`, `region_preference`)
|
||
2. Tech specs calculation with **DB workload multiplier** based on use_case
|
||
3. Candidate filtering with **flexible region matching**
|
||
4. VPS benchmarks retrieval (Geekbench 6), **prioritizing same provider**
|
||
5. AI analysis returns 3 tiers: Budget, Balanced, Premium
|
||
6. Results cached in KV (5 min TTL, empty results not cached)
|
||
|
||
### D1 Database Tables (cloud-instances-db)
|
||
|
||
- `providers` - Cloud providers (50+)
|
||
- `instance_types` - Server specifications
|
||
- `pricing` - Regional pricing
|
||
- `regions` - Geographic regions
|
||
- `tech_specs` - Resource requirements per technology (vcpu_per_users, min_memory_mb)
|
||
- `vps_benchmarks` - Geekbench 6 benchmark data (269 records)
|
||
- `benchmark_results` / `benchmark_types` / `processors` - Phoronix benchmark data

## Key Implementation Details
|
||
|
||
### DB Workload Multiplier (`recommend.ts`)
|
||
|
||
Database resource requirements vary by workload type, not just user count:
|
||
|
||
| Workload Type | Multiplier | Example Use Cases |
|
||
|---------------|------------|-------------------|
|
||
| Heavy | 0.3x | analytics, log server, reporting, dashboard |
|
||
| Medium-Heavy | 0.5x | e-commerce, ERP, CRM, community forum |
|
||
| Medium | 0.7x | API, SaaS, app backend |
|
||
| Light | 1.0x | blog, portfolio, documentation, wiki |
|
||
|
||
**Example**: PostgreSQL (vcpu_per_users: 200) with 1000 users
|
||
- Analytics dashboard: 1000 / (200 × 0.3) = 17 vCPU
|
||
- E-commerce: 1000 / (200 × 0.5) = 10 vCPU
|
||
- Personal blog: 1000 / (200 × 1.0) = 5 vCPU
|
||
|
||
### Bandwidth Estimation (`bandwidth.ts`)
|
||
|
||
Estimates monthly bandwidth based on use_case patterns:
|
||
|
||
| Pattern | Page Size | Pages/Day | Active Ratio |
|
||
|---------|-----------|-----------|--------------|
|
||
| E-commerce | 2.5MB | 20 | 40% |
|
||
| Streaming | 50MB | 5 | 20% |
|
||
| Analytics | 0.7MB | 30 | 50% |
|
||
| Blog/Content | 1.5MB | 4 | 30% |
|
||
|
||
Heavy bandwidth (>1TB/month) prefers Linode for included bandwidth.
|
||
|
||
### Flexible Region Matching (`candidates.ts`)
|
||
|
||
Region matching supports multiple input formats:
|
||
```sql
|
||
LOWER(r.region_code) = ? OR
|
||
LOWER(r.region_code) LIKE ? OR
|
||
LOWER(r.region_name) LIKE ? OR
|
||
LOWER(r.country_code) = ?
|
||
```
|
||
|
||
Valid inputs: `"korea"`, `"KR"`, `"seoul"`, `"ap-northeast-2"`, `"icn"`
|
||
|
||
### AI Prompt Strategy (`ai.ts`)
|
||
|
||
- Uses OpenAI GPT-4o-mini via Cloudflare AI Gateway (bypasses regional restrictions)
|
||
- Server list format: `[server_id=XXXX] Provider Name...` for accurate ID extraction
|
||
- Scoring: Cost efficiency (40%) + Capacity fit (30%) + Scalability (30%)
|
||
- Capacity response in Korean for Korean users
